Glossaire

Les sections suivantes proposent des définitions pour les termes associés à GKE On-Prem et Kubernetes.

Vous pouvez également consulter les pages suivantes :

A

Cluster d'administrateur

Cluster qui crée des clusters d'utilisateur et gère leurs plans de contrôle. Tous les appels d'API vers et depuis GKE On-Prem sont gérés par le plan de contrôle d'administrateur qui s'exécute dans le cluster d'administrateur.

Plan de contrôle d'administrateur

Plan de contrôle exécuté dans le cluster d'administrateur.

Ce plan de contrôle gère spécifiquement tous les appels d'API Kubernetes vers et depuis GKE On-Prem : lorsqu'un appel d'API est effectué, il est dirigé vers le plan de contrôle d'administrateur pour traitement, puis est acheminé vers la destination souhaitée. Le plan de contrôle d'administrateur gère le cycle de vie complet des clusters d'utilisateur, y compris la création, la mise à niveau et la suppression. Il exécute des services qui interagissent avec vSphere et l'agent Connect.

C

CLI

Acronyme de "command-line interface", qui signifie "interface de ligne de commande"

Groupe

Ce terme peut faire référence aux éléments suivants :

Fichier de configuration

Également appelé "fichier config". Ce terme peut faire référence aux éléments suivants :

À ne pas confondre avec une ressource Kubernetes ConfigMap.

Plan de contrôle

Unité de contrôle d'un cluster, composée d'un ensemble de composants qui planifient et gèrent les charges de travail, communique avec les clusters et s'assure qu'ils fonctionnent. Les plans de contrôle incluent le datastore de paires clé-valeur etcd, le serveur d'API Kubernetes, le programmeur et le gestionnaire de contrôleurs. Reportez-vous également à la documentation de Kubernetes pour en savoir plus sur le plan de contrôle Kubernetes.

D

Centre de données

Ce terme peut faire référence aux éléments suivants :

  • L'emplacement physique d'une installation hébergeant des périphériques de stockage et des ordinateurs en réseau
  • Le centre de données vCenter virtuel. Selon la documentation de VMware : "Un conteneur pour tous les objets d'inventaire nécessaires à l'exécution d'un environnement entièrement fonctionnel pour le fonctionnement des machines virtuelles".

Deployment

Voir Déploiement.

Distributed Resource Scheduler (DRS)

Utilitaire VMware qui distribue dynamiquement la capacité de calcul des VM entre des groupes d'hôtes physiques.

G

gkectl

Interface de ligne de commande (CLI) vers GKE On-Prem. Vous utilisez gkectl pour créer et gérer des clusters GKE On-Prem, ainsi que pour diagnostiquer les problèmes liés aux clusters.

H

Haute disponibilité (HA)

Ce terme peut faire référence aux éléments suivants :

  • La haute disponibilité vSphere, une fonctionnalité qui redémarre automatiquement les VM sur un hôte disponible en cas de défaillance d'une VM
  • Le concept de haute disponibilité qui décrit la haute résilience d'un système informatique aux pannes

host

Machine physique qui s'exécute dans un centre de données. Également appelé "serveur". Les machines virtuelles sont déployées sur des hôtes.

I

Mode île

GKE On-Prem ne crée pas de réseau superposé pour la mise en réseau d'un cluster. Au lieu de cela, il crée un réseau maillé nœud à nœud à l'aide de BGP afin que les pods puissent communiquer entre eux au sein du cluster à l'aide du réseau sous-jacent existant. Toutefois, ce réseau n'est pas directement accessible depuis l'extérieur du cluster, car les routages sont uniquement annoncés entre les nœuds qui composent le cluster. Cette configuration est appelée mise en réseau en mode île, car elle peut être considérée comme une île au sein du réseau sur site existant.

M

Machine

Ce terme peut faire référence aux éléments suivants :

Fichier manifeste

Ce terme peut faire référence aux éléments suivants :

  • Un fichier de configuration YAML Kubernetes
  • La spécification de

N

Nœud

Ce terme peut faire référence aux éléments suivants :

  • Une machine de nœud de calcul s'exécutant dans un cluster Kubernetes. Un cluster est composé de plusieurs nœuds.

  • Une machine virtuelle vSphere dans un cluster GKE On-Prem. Également appelée "VM" ou "machine".

  • Une ressource de nœud d'API Cluster qui sert de lien symbolique vers une machine de nœud de calcul dans un cluster Kubernetes

O

Objet

Ce terme fait généralement référence à une ressource Kubernetes.

P

Pod

Objet Kubernetes qui exécute une charge de travail en conteneur. Il s'agit de la plus petite unité de calcul déployable dans Kubernetes. Les pods sont généralement gérés par un autre objet, comme un objet de déploiement ou un StatefulSet. Reportez-vous également à la documentation de Kubernetes pour en savoir plus sur les objets Pod.

R

Ressource

Ce terme peut faire référence aux éléments suivants :

Pool de ressources

Dans GKE On-Prem, il s'agit simplement d'un ensemble de VM dans un cluster vSphere. En savoir plus sur les pools de ressources.

S

Service

Objet Kubernetes qui regroupe logiquement un ensemble de pods et définit une règle permettant d'y accéder. Reportez-vous également à la documentation de Kubernetes pour en savoir plus sur les objets Service.

StatefulSet

Objet Kubernetes destiné aux applications avec état. Les pods gérés par un StatefulSet obtiennent une identité unique et persistante dans leur cluster. Reportez-vous également à la documentation de Kubernetes pour en savoir plus sur les objets StatefulSet.

U

Cluster d'utilisateur

Un cluster dans lequel sont exécutées les charges de travail Kubernetes des développeurs. Les clusters d'utilisateur sont gérés par un cluster d'administrateur.

V

Système de fichiers de machine virtuelle (VMFS, Virtual Machine File System)

Système de fichiers de cluster pour ESXi.

vCenter

Interface utilisateur Web de vSphere pour la gestion des services de centre de données. Il fournit une vue centrale sur les hôtes ESXi.

vSphere

Suite de produits de virtualisation de VMware incluant vCenter et ESXi.

Client vSphere

Également appelé "Client Web vSphere", il s'agit de l'interface de gestion Web de VMware qui vous permet de vous connecter au serveur vCenter.

Machine virtuelle (VM)

Émulation d'un système informatique avec une architecture et des spécifications matérielles spécifiques. Remplace le matériel de la machine physique. Les VM sont déployées sur des hôtes, des machines physiques s'exécutant dans un centre de données. GKE On-Prem crée et utilise des clusters de VM vSphere pour déployer des clusters GKE On-Prem.